Course Curriculum Overview

4

For each semester, there is atleast one non curricular course added for the students to gain interest. The aspects of the curriculum that influenced my decision to choose this course was that the course has up to date things required for cyber security. The Peace related subject for each semester helps the student to be a better person. The areas for improvement in the course can be like implementation of certain real world practicals. The semester exams takes place 2 times in an year , one in May and the another one in December.

Internships Opportunities

3.5

There are many companies visiting for the internship in the college. To name a few, there is PhonePe, Bugsmirror, CrowdStrike, Credence, Infosys, TCS, Accenture, etc. Typically the role for now is just the Software Developer or the Web Developer.

Placement Experience

3.5

From 7th semester, the students become eligible for campus placements. Almost 100-150 companies visit the college. The highest package is 51.36 lpa and the average is 7 lpa. Percentage of students getting placements is 80%.

Fees and Financial Aid

The tuition fees remains same for all four years you are doing engineering. The college doesn't ask for any money from the student other than this. The complete cost is around 3.55 lakh per year. The college provides a merit based scholarship based on the marks got in JEE and MHT-CET. The name is "Dr. Vishwanath Karad Merit based scholarship". The College also provides campus employment like internships but no stipend is provided.

Campus Life

5

Annually MIT Fest is organised named "AAROHAN". Also every department hosts it's own technical fest every 3-4 months. Knowledge Resource Centre (KRC) is a separate building, named ‘Agastya’, which has the area of 3056 sq.m (Basement + 6 Floors). The library supports teaching, learning, research and the vision of the university. The library is operational for twelve hours and this facility is extended during the exam period. It has an enormous collection of resources to support all programs under the university. It has a dedicated reading space, discussion rooms, and faculty space, all together with a total seating capacity of more than 2000. The college has 350+ Hi-tech classrooms equipped with smartboards and LCD projectors to facilitate a better understanding of the subject matter. Admission

The admission process is carried out through MIT WPU Entrance exams. The exam dates and the application fees is not fixed. One can apply on the link , the MIT WPU team will then contact you, the difficulty of the exam is more than MHT-CET and less than JEE mains. There is no reservations provided in the college.

Faculty

4

So, like in the Computer Science and Engineering there are almost 1000 students including AIDS, Cyber security and CSBS. In the whole CSE Dept, there are almost 20 faculties including HOD, Prof, Asst. Prof and Associate Prof., So there is 1:20 faculty to student ratio. Most of the professors are P.Hd in their respective courses related to Computer Science and rest have atleast a Master's Degree. Most of the faculties have deep understanding in their subject and each faculty is ready with any doubt asked to them. The student - teacher bond, I would say is great here, the teachers are ready to address each difficulties the student is facing. The teachers here are more mentors than the faculties.
